Offline | you guys aren't the only ones! my GP, 1719, had the exact same problem but started when i went on long weekend to a game farm here in south africa. man! i got some really dirty looks from people who had gone there to enjoy the peace and quiet! apparently, the guys at mini told me that the stresses the jcw/gp places on the welds are what cause the problem. you would think that after 3 years of the jcw kit being available they would have beefed up the exhaust sytem, yes? |
